Abstract
This Intended Use Plan (IUP), required under the SDWA, describes how South Carolina proposes to use available SRF funds for State Fiscal Year (SFY) 2019 (July 1, 2018 through June 30, 2019) including federal funds allocated to South Carolina by the Consolidated Appropriations Act, 2018, and how those uses support the objectives of the SDWA in the protection of public health. South Carolina’s allotment from the federal appropriations for federal fiscal year (FFY) 2018 is $14,385,000. Eligibility for DWSRF loans and DWSRF program requirements, including any requirements of the applicable appropriations legislation are also included in the IUP.
